So you picked up Corsair Down, but what does it do? This guide will tell you What To Do With Corsair Down In Destiny 2: Forsaken so you can complete the Pursuit, find a couple of hidden objectives and more importantly, net yourself some Legendary Gear.

Corsair Down is a random item you can collect that enters into your Pursuits section of your inventory. While its drop rate is random, there’s a very high chance of getting it if you participate in the Divalian Mist Public Event. It’s a difficult event with the suggested Light Level of 540 but even if you fail, you can still often loot yourself a Corsair Down item.

What To Do With Corsair Down In Destiny 2: Forsaken

This is where the challenging aspect comes into play. You need to discover the location of a lost body. If you inspect your Corsair Down item in your Pursuits section of your inventory, it will give you a slight clue as to where you need to go. Remember to check your Corsair Down item in your inventory for one of the following clues.

Repeating Something About A Harbinger

Repeating Something About A Harbinger
You need to search deep inside the Cathedral. Harbingers Seclude. The exact location of the body changes.

Repeating Something About A Chamber

Repeating Something About A Chamber
The Lost Sector North West of The Strand. We were unable to travel far due to the 560 Light Level requirement.

You get the Corsair Down very early but it’s much easier to wait until 550ish Light Level so you can freely explore without fear of death. Once you find the body, scan it and defeat the boss.
